The Napa Valley College women's soccer team concluded its 2023 fall season, traveling to Mendocino College in Ukiah and battling to a 2-2 tie in a Bay Valley Conference match on Nov. 9.

The Storm (5-8-2 overall, 4-6-2 Bay Valley) finishes the conference season in fifth place.

Napa Valley and Mendocino were tied 1-1 at halftime.

Each team scored a goal in the second half. Annie Sanchez, a freshman forward, scored the Storm's first goal, coming at the 3-minute mark of the game. The assist went to Riann Palomo, a freshman center half.

Mendocino scored the next two goals of the game.

Napa Valley tied it, at the 90-minute mark, on a goal by Areli Ramirez-Ruiz, a sophomore defender. The assist went to Palomo.

Ariel Nunez had six saves at goal keeper for the Storm.
